well if none of the i3/i5's come witha graphics card (besides the integrated hd3000/4000 that is) - then the A6's will game much better but the intels are the stronger cpu computationally.

There are also model sof the a6 that have a 2nd graphics card added and run them both in hybrid crossfire that perform even better in games. I would look for one of those.

I am going to assume you are looking into laptops and not desktops: The A6 has a discrete-class gpu which would destroy the Intel HD Graphics x000. However, the A6 cpu would be beat by an i5. A6 is better for better graphics, i5 for better processor. Overall, the A6 would be better for gaming IMHO.
